What is Integrative Medicine for Autoimmune Conditions?
Integrative medicine is a healing-oriented medicine that takes account of the whole person (body, mind, and spirit), including all aspects of lifestyle. It emphasizes the therapeutic relationship and makes use of all appropriate therapies, both conventional and complementary.
For autoimmune conditions, an integrative approach typically involves:
Root Cause Investigation: Unlike conventional medicine, which often focuses on symptom suppression, integrative medicine (particularly functional medicine, a subset of integrative medicine) delves deep to identify the underlying triggers and imbalances contributing to autoimmunity. These can include:
Gut Dysfunction: Leaky gut (intestinal permeability), dysbiosis (imbalance of gut bacteria).
Nutrient Deficiencies: Especially Vitamin D, Omega-3 fatty acids, Zinc, Selenium, and B vitamins.
Chronic Infections: Viral, bacterial, or fungal infections that can trigger immune responses.
Environmental Toxins: Exposure to heavy metals, pesticides, molds, and other chemicals.
Chronic Stress: Affecting the nervous and endocrine systems, which profoundly influence immune function.
Food Sensitivities/Intolerances: Specific foods (like gluten or dairy) that can trigger inflammation.
Hormonal Imbalances: Affecting immune regulation.
Genetic Predisposition: While genetics load the gun, environment and lifestyle pull the trigger.
Personalized Treatment Plans: No two autoimmune journeys are identical. Integrative approaches create highly individualized plans based on comprehensive testing and the patient's unique history and triggers.
Combination of Therapies: Integrating conventional treatments (medications, biologics) with evidence-based complementary therapies.
Key Pillars of Integrative Medicine Approaches for Autoimmune Conditions
Diet and Nutrition:
Anti-Inflammatory Diets: Emphasizing whole, unprocessed foods, abundant fruits and vegetables, lean proteins, and healthy fats (e.g., Mediterranean diet).
Elimination Diets (e.g., Autoimmune Protocol - AIP): Temporarily removing common inflammatory foods (like gluten, dairy, grains, legumes, nightshades, eggs, nuts, seeds, processed sugars) and reintroducing them systematically to identify individual triggers.
Gut Healing Foods: Bone broth, fermented foods, soluble fiber, and specific prebiotics/probiotics.
Nutrient Optimization: Ensuring adequate intake of vitamins, minerals, and phytonutrients crucial for immune regulation and inflammation control.
Gut Health Restoration:
Testing: Comprehensive stool analysis to assess microbiome balance, digestive enzyme function, and presence of pathogens.
Strategies: Diet modification, targeted probiotics and prebiotics, digestive enzymes, L-Glutamine, zinc carnosine, and other gut-healing supplements.
Stress Management & Mind-Body Practices:
Techniques: Mindfulness meditation, yoga, tai chi, deep breathing exercises, biofeedback, counseling, and psychotherapy.
Rationale: Chronic stress significantly impacts the immune system and can trigger or worsen autoimmune flares.
Targeted Supplementation:
Vitamin D: Crucial for immune modulation.
Omega-3 Fatty Acids: Potent anti-inflammatory properties.
Curcumin (Turmeric): Powerful natural anti-inflammatory.
Probiotics: To rebalance the gut microbiome.
Antioxidants: Vitamin C, E, Alpha-Lipoic Acid, Glutathione to combat oxidative stress.
Botanicals: Herbs with immunomodulatory or anti-inflammatory properties (e.g., ginger, green tea extract, Boswellia).
Detoxification Support:
Reducing Toxin Exposure: Minimizing exposure to environmental toxins (e.g., in food, water, personal care products).
Supporting Detox Pathways: Encouraging liver and kidney function through specific nutrients, herbs, and practices like sweating (sauna).
Optimizing Sleep: Crucial for immune function, hormone regulation, and overall healing.
Appropriate Physical Activity: Regular, gentle exercise helps reduce inflammation, improve mood, and support immune health, but should be tailored to individual energy levels and disease activity.
